Turtles have long been considered the most primitive of all living reptiles, in large part because their skulls lack temporal openings, which all later reptiles possess. The fossil history of turtles begins in the late Triassic. The first turtles were fairly large, terrestrial or semi-aquatic animals. They were thickly built and had armored tails. Anatomically, turtles have changed little since the late Triassic. Perhaps the most significant difference between primitive and modern turtles is that primitive turtles had teeth.
